University of Georgia in Athens is seeking a farm assistant to support day-to-day operations of a 600-acre plant science research farm, interacting with CAES faculty, staff, and students, and operating tractors and other equipment.
The role involves applying fertilizers and pesticides, land preparation, soil sampling, and general farm maintenance, with emphasis on safety, teamwork, and attention to detail.
Assists the farm manager with day-to-day operations of a 600‑acre plant science research farm. Responsibilities include interacting with CAES research faculty, staff, and students; operating agricultural equipment such as tractors, harvesters, and guidance systems; applying fertilizers and pesticides; conducting land preparation and soil sampling; and performing general farm maintenance and repair.
